Abstract

This review recapitulates the recent knowledge accumulation on overgrowth syndrome related to gain of function of the phosphoinositide3 kinase (PI3K)-alpha. These disorders, known as PIK3CA related overgrowth syndromes (PROS) are caused by somatic PIK3CA mutation occurring during embryogenesis. We summarize here the currently available animal models and new treatments undergoing development.
